Sensex, Nifty trade higher in morning trade

(Getty Images)

Extending gains for fourth-straight session, Indian equity markets started Wednesday’s trading session on a positive note. 
At 9.50 am, the Sensex at the BSE was trading 32 points up at 26,456 while the Nifty at the NSE was trading 18 points higher at 8,160.
Broader markets outperformed the front liners, BSE Midcap and Smallcap indices surged 0.5 per cent and 0.9 per cent respectively. 
Among the BSE sectoral indices, Consumer Durables index jumped the most, up 1 per cent, while Telecom index became the top loser, down 0.5 per cent. 
On Tuesday, the Sensex had closed 44 points up at 26,394 and the Nifty had ended 15 points higher at 8,142.
Top gainers in the Sensex-30 pack: Adani Ports (up 1.7 per cent), ICICI Bank (up 1.3 per cent), Asian Paints (up 1.2 per cent), Maruti Suzuki (up 1.2 per cent) and Lupin (up 0.9 per cent).
Top losers in the Sensex-30 pack: ITC (down 0.5 per cent), Tata Motors (down 0.5 per cent), Hero Motocorp (down 0.4 per cent), Tata Steel (down 0.3 per cent) and Axis Bank (down 0.3 per cent).
Meanwhile, the Rupee was trading three paise higher at 68.62 against the US Dollar.
